About Gaming Law in Irvine, United States:

Gaming law in Irvine, United States refers to the regulations and statutes that govern various aspects of the gaming industry, including casinos, online gambling, esports, and fantasy sports. These laws are designed to ensure fair play, protect consumers, prevent money laundering, and uphold the integrity of the gaming industry.

Frequently Asked Questions:

1. Is online gambling legal in Irvine, United States?

Online gambling laws vary by state, but in Irvine, United States, online gambling is generally prohibited except for specific authorized activities.

2. What is the minimum age to participate in gaming activities in Irvine, United States?

The minimum age to gamble in Irvine, United States is typically 21 years old for casinos and 18 years old for other gaming activities.

3. Do I need a license to operate a gaming business in Irvine, United States?

Yes, gaming businesses in Irvine, United States are required to obtain a license from the appropriate regulatory body.

4. What are the consequences of operating an illegal gaming business in Irvine, United States?

Operating an illegal gaming business in Irvine, United States can result in criminal charges, fines, and even imprisonment.

9. Can I legally participate in fantasy sports contests in Irvine, United States?

Fantasy sports contests are legal in most states, including Irvine, United States, but there may be specific regulations that apply to these activities.
